Documents:Mobile App Training
Jump to navigation
Jump to search
| S.No | Content | Native iOS | Native Android | React Native | |
|---|---|---|---|---|---|
| 1 | Requirements Analysis | Make it as document | |||
| 2 | Software Installations | Mac OS, Xcode | Any OS, Android Studio | Mac OS, Visual Studio Code, Android Studio, Xcode | |
| 3 | Sprint Planning | Jira | |||
| 4 | Development | As per sprint planning | |||
| 5 | Testing | iPhone Device | Android Mobile | iPhone & Android Mobile | |
| 6 | Project Release | As per sprint planning | |||
| 7 | Development Skill | 1. Project Creation
2. Project Run 3. Debugging 4. Create Build 5. App publish |
Done | Done | Done |
| 8 | Mobile App Dev Sessions | [Link 1](https://nextcloud.pheonixsolutions.com/index.php/s/cwLso89LR5RZLeq) | [Link 2](https://nextcloud.pheonixsolutions.com/index.php/s/NTxoW4NXpgSRmaa) | ||
| 9 | Prakash K | Testing Team | |||
| 10 | Dev Team | Yet to learn | Known Tech | ||
| 11 | Mobile App Automation | Manual Testing | |||
| 12 | Razorpay Payment Integration | Reference | Design | Apache JMeter / Load Runner for performance testing | API Testing (Both manual & Automation) |
| 13 | Stripe Payment Integration | Reference | API Integration | Suggest to buy a BrowserStack package for mobile apps testing with various screens | BrowserStack |
| 14 | MVVM Model | [Link](#) | [Link 2](#) | Validation | |
| 15 | App Publish in the Google Play Store | Android Development | |||
| 16 | App Crash Issue | Proper Debugging / Implement Crashlytics | Reference | ||
| 17 | Gmail Integration | Reference | Alternative Reference | ||
| 18 | Backend | Refer to the Grocery/Cognihealth source code | |||
| 19 | iOS Development and App Publish | [Link](#) | |||
| 20 | Redux | Refer | |||
| 21 | Native Android | [Link](#) | |||
| 22 | Native iOS | [Link](#) | |||
| 23 | Tools Required | Tools Required | |||
| 24 | Mac System | Always use the latest Mac OS and Xcode version | |||
| 25 | Apple Device | 1 | Always keep with updated iOS version | ||
| 26 | Android Device | 1 | Always keep with updated Android version | ||
| 27 | Mobile Sims | To test OTP in different networks | |||
| 28 | Simulators for Cloud Testing | BrowserStack |